I don't want to quit his method, I just want to modify it.

I have memorized the first 500 characters.

I want to skip ahead and just learn all of the primitives. That way I can start reading and just look up words and make up stories as I go along.

How would you suggest I go about finding all of the primitives and learning them.

Also, if you think this is a bad idea, please tell me why.

There is a book called Chinese Characters by Dr. L. Wieger that covers character origin entymology, history, classification, and signification. Some may think this book is outdated however, it does cover the (primitive) character origin.
